In Brave and surrounding Greene County, we frequently see suspension and brake wear on Dodge trucks and SUVs from navigating our hilly, rural roads. Rust prevention is also a critical service due to winter road treatments and moisture. Regular undercarriage inspections are highly recommended for local Dodge owners.
Look for a shop with certified technicians specifically trained on Dodge/Chrysler vehicles (ASE or Mopar certification is a plus). Ask local neighbors for referrals and check online reviews for shops in Brave or nearby towns like Waynesburg, focusing on those with long-standing community presence and transparency in diagnostics.
Seek immediate service for warning lights like the check engine or electronic throttle control light, unusual transmission shifting, or brake issues, especially before tackling our steep local terrain. Schedule routine check-ups before winter to prepare for cold starts and before summer road trips to ensure cooling system integrity.
Labor rates in Brave are often more competitive than in major metropolitan areas like Pittsburgh. However, parts availability for specific Dodge models may sometimes cause slight delays, so choosing a shop with strong supplier relationships is key to managing both cost and repair time effectively.
Given our climate, prioritize seasonal tire changes and battery testing before winter, as cold snaps can be severe. Using a local shop familiar with the wear from gravel roads and seasonal potholes ensures they can spot and address chassis and alignment issues specific to our area.
